1. Technology and Mechanism of VelaShape

VelaShape utilizes a combination of infrared light, bi-polar radio frequency energy, and vacuum suction. This technology targets fat cells and stimulates collagen production, leading to smoother skin and reduced circumference. The mechanism is designed to be non-invasive, minimizing the risk of serious side effects. In Dallas, many clinics use FDA-cleared devices, ensuring that the technology meets high safety standards.

3. Potential Side Effects and Risks

While VelaShape is generally safe, like any medical treatment, it carries some potential side effects. These can include temporary redness, swelling, and tenderness at the treatment site. However, these effects are usually mild and resolve within a few days. Serious complications are rare but can include burns or skin discoloration. Choosing a reputable clinic and experienced practitioner significantly reduces these risks.

4. Client Suitability and Pre-Treatment Consultations

Not all individuals are suitable candidates for VelaShape. Pre-treatment consultations are essential to assess the client's health history and skin condition. Clients with certain medical conditions, such as pregnancy or active skin infections, may not be suitable for the treatment. These consultations also provide an opportunity for practitioners to tailor the treatment to the individual's needs, ensuring safety and effectiveness.

5. Post-Treatment Care and Follow-Up

Proper post-treatment care is crucial to maximize the benefits and ensure safety. Clients are typically advised to avoid intense physical activity and direct sun exposure for a few days after the treatment. Regular follow-up appointments are also important to monitor the progress and address any concerns. Clinics in Dallas often provide detailed aftercare instructions to support clients through the recovery process.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: How many VelaShape treatments are needed?
A: Typically, a series of 3-6 treatments spaced a week or two apart is recommended for optimal results.

Q: Is there any downtime after VelaShape?
A: VelaShape is non-invasive and generally does not require downtime. Clients can resume normal activities immediately after the treatment.

Q: Who should avoid VelaShape?
A: Individuals with certain medical conditions, such as pregnancy, active skin infections, or pacemakers, should avoid VelaShape. It is important to consult with a healthcare provider before undergoing the treatment.

Q: How long do the results last?
A: The longevity of results can vary depending on individual factors. However, with proper maintenance and lifestyle choices, the results can be sustained for an extended period.
